Transaction 36a3ef76569cc189ff49651ba259fdf224793b45b601fb91dc86fa6160b81aae

1 Input
2 Outputs
  • 36a3ef76569cc189ff49651ba259fdf224793b45b601fb91dc86fa6160b81aae:0
  • value  20770176
    address  bc1qmx4f9e9lrz28danklg67drytravp6jd2zqk3tg
  • 36a3ef76569cc189ff49651ba259fdf224793b45b601fb91dc86fa6160b81aae:1
  • value  2699859099
    address  14s8N6NraQrmDrAmuBAErSu1r6EgsbW5U7